  • GX 145: A Fun Fact

    So, in both the TV rip and the DVD episode (surprisingly, since things like these get fixed on the DVDs), as Dogma Guy’s being summoned, you hear him grunt and the ATK counter come up seconds before he actually poses and the counter actually pops up.  For some reason. I checked if 4Kids had it fixed in the dub, and it’s still there, only you also hear the dub’s stat counter SFX after the JP one. It’s not the first time they’ve goofed with SFX, since, if you watch dub!130 as Rainbow Dragon’s powering up to 10,000 ATK, you actually hear the Japanese stat-increasing SFX.  And apparently, in dub!145, they also kept JP!Echo’s scream as Exodia grabbed her and put dub!Echo’s scream over hers.  Yeah, I dunno.

    To fix this, being the awesome or just lucky editor that I am, I sped up Dogma Guy’s posing so it and the counter were timed with their respective SFXs.  And now, it looks a lot less awkward!
